Why Customers Prefer WhatsApp Over Email: A Comprehensive Guide

With over 2 billion users worldwide, WhatsApp is not just an app for personal chats anymore. It has become the preferred way for customers to interact with businesses. But why exactly do customers choose WhatsApp over traditional channels like email and phone? In this article, we break down the 5 most important reasons — and what this means for your business. ---

1. Instant Responses, No Waiting

Customers hate waiting. Whether it's a queue on the phone or an email that takes 24 hours to get a reply — slow responses kill customer satisfaction. WhatsApp changes this completely. Customers expect (and receive) fast replies, often within minutes. Key stat: 82% of customers expect an immediate response to sales or marketing questions (HubSpot).

Practical Tips for Instant Communication

1. **Use Quick Replies**: Set up predefined responses for frequently asked questions. This can drastically reduce the response time. 2. **Leverage Chatbots**: Implement AI chatbots to answer common queries. For instance, if you run an e-commerce store, your chatbot can provide order status updates instantly. 3. **Monitor Response Times**: Use analytics tools to track response times and identify areas for improvement. Aim for replies within five minutes. 4. **Set Expectations**: Clearly communicate your response times on your WhatsApp profile to manage customer expectations effectively. ---

2. It Feels Personal, Not Corporate

Email feels formal. Phone calls feel intrusive. WhatsApp hits the sweet spot — it's personal, casual, and feels like chatting with a friend. This matters because **customers are more likely to engage** with messages that feel personal. WhatsApp messages have an average open rate of **98%**, compared to just 20% for email. Creating a Personal Touch in Communication

- **Personalized Messages**: Address customers by their names and reference past interactions. For example, "Hi John, I see you recently purchased a pair of shoes. How are you finding them?" - **Use Emojis**: Emojis can make your messages feel friendly and warm. However, use them judiciously to maintain professionalism. - **Share Behind-the-Scenes Content**: Occasionally share stories or images of your team or processes. This humanizes your brand and builds a connection. - **Ask for Feedback**: Engaging customers by asking for their opinions on products or services fosters a sense of belonging. ---

3. Rich Media Makes Communication Better

Try sending a product video via a support ticket. Or sharing a PDF invoice via a phone call. It doesn't work. WhatsApp supports: - 📸 **Images** — Send product photos, screenshots, or how-to visuals - 🎥 **Videos** — Share tutorials, product demos, or onboarding clips - 📄 **Documents** — Send invoices, contracts, or manuals as PDFs - 📍 **Location** — Share store locations or delivery tracking - 🎙️ **Voice messages** — For when typing takes too long This rich media support makes WhatsApp conversations more effective and reduces the back-and-forth that plagues email threads.

Examples of Effective Rich Media Use

- **Product Demonstrations**: A furniture store could send a video showing how to assemble a product, enhancing customer understanding. - **Visual FAQs**: Create infographics or short video clips that address common customer questions, making the information more digestible. - **Interactive Content**: Encourage customers to share their experiences by asking them to send pictures of products in use. This not only increases engagement but also serves as valuable user-generated content. - **Event Promotions**: Use rich media to promote events. For instance, send a video invitation for a product launch, making it visually appealing. ---

4. Conversations Stay in One Place

With email, customers lose track of threads. With phone, there's no written record. WhatsApp keeps **the entire conversation history** in one place, easily searchable and always accessible. Benefits of a Centralized Conversation History

| Benefit | WhatsApp | Email | |---------------------------|-----------------------------------------------|---------------------------------------------| | **Searchability** | Easy to search within the app | Advanced search features often lacking | | **Thread Management** | All conversations in one place | Threads can become confusing with multiple replies | | **Context Retention** | Entire history is visible | Customers may forget previous emails | | **Accessibility** | Accessible on mobile devices | May require desktop access for full features | - **Tagging Conversations**: Use tags to categorize conversations by issue type or customer status, making it easier for teams to find relevant discussions. - **Regular Updates**: Encourage customers to check back on their conversation history for any updates rather than reaching out again. ---

5. Customers Are Already There

This is perhaps the simplest but most powerful reason: **your customers are already using WhatsApp every day**. In the Netherlands, over **13 million people** use WhatsApp daily. In Belgium, Germany, Spain, Brazil, India, and dozens of other countries, it's the dominant messaging app. By offering WhatsApp as a communication channel, you're meeting customers where they already are — instead of forcing them to download a new app, create an account, or navigate a clunky contact form. Understanding Your Audience's Preferences

- **Conduct Surveys**: Regularly ask your customers about their preferred communication channels. This data can guide your strategy. - **Analyze Customer Behavior**: Use analytics to identify how customers interact with your brand on WhatsApp compared to other channels. - **Test and Optimize**: Experiment with different types of messages or customer engagement strategies on WhatsApp. Monitor which approaches yield the best results. ---

What This Means for Your Business

The shift to WhatsApp isn't a trend — it's a fundamental change in how customers want to communicate. Businesses that adapt now gain a competitive edge through: - **Higher response rates** (98% open rate vs. 20% for email) - **Faster resolution times** (minutes vs. hours or days) - **Stronger customer relationships** (personal, two-way conversations) - **Lower support costs** (automation + AI reduces manual workload)

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the benefits of using WhatsApp for customer service?

Using WhatsApp for customer service allows for instant communication, personalized interactions, and the ability to send rich media, all of which enhance the customer experience.

How can I integrate WhatsApp with my existing customer service tools?

You can integrate WhatsApp with your customer service tools using platforms like Bugalou, which offers seamless integration options with CRMs and other customer support systems.

Is WhatsApp secure for customer communications?

Yes, WhatsApp uses end-to-end encryption, meaning that your messages are secure and cannot be read by anyone else, including WhatsApp itself.

What types of businesses can benefit from WhatsApp?

Any business that interacts with customers can benefit from WhatsApp, including e-commerce, retail, hospitality, and service industries. It is particularly effective for businesses with a younger demographic that prefers messaging apps.
